General Scope and Summary

SAGE Therapeutics is searching for a creative, resourceful, and integrative thinker for an important Principal Scientist role in CNS research. This role requires a track record of scientific leadership in drug discovery and nonclinical development, including early research and lead optimization projects. The position will be responsible for developing scientific strategies to support programs across the pipeline, integrating data and information across functional areas to identify key biological and scientific insights, and ensuring seamless communication of these insights across the broader organization to contribute to franchise and corporate-level goals and initiatives. The role requires a very strong team player with excellent critical thinking and communication skills who can deliver exceptional results in a fast-paced and innovative environment. 

Roles and Responsibilities

  • Develop creative and innovative research strategies to answer key strategic questions in the R&D portfolio. 

  • Drive research and development strategy as a program lead on early research, lead optimization, and/or clinical development teams. 

  • Provide scientific leadership as a pharmacology/research representative on early research, lead optimization, and/or clinical development teams.   

  • Maintain knowledge of state-of-the-art principles and theories and apply this knowledge to the design, execution, and interpretation of experiments. 

  • Design and interpret in vivo pharmacology studies to evaluate the activities of small molecule drug candidates, investigate their mechanisms of action, and explore novel therapeutic hypotheses. 

  • Plan, coordinate, and study manage the execution of laboratory research through CROs, including monitoring workflows to enable study execution; this workstream can include investigation, selection, and/or development of new methods and technologies for project advancement. 

  • Manage in vivo pharmacology research in a matrixed environment, including an extensive network of CROs, with the goal of effectively communicating data summaries, interpretation, and next steps. 

  • Contribute to the preparation of scientific reports for functional review and project teams. 

  • Prepare, review, and deliver scientific presentations for internal/external use. 

  • Be a recognized expert in CNS research within the organization, providing scientific expertise and communicating key insights across departments to support franchise-level activities and inform key program and portfolio-level decisions. 

  • Contribute to execution of research plans through data collection and integrated analyses. 

  • Think strategically about drug development and drive innovative solutions to key challenges across the organization. 

  • Work collaboratively with internal and external groups, including academic partners and contract research organizations, to execute research strategies. 

  • Work cross-functionally to support the internal and external scientific communications strategy. 

  • Contribute to the generation of new target identification and validation efforts within the early research portfolio. 

  • Provide expertise to inform assessment of discovery-stage business development opportunities. 

  • Author high-quality regulatory documents, strategic whitepapers, and scientific publications.  

  • Manage stakeholders across the organization and develop collaborative relationships with key opinion leaders to drive results of corporate initiatives.
